Output 88f75544664fcdbb18e292f7e8adb605d3db824fc5ce998ff65cabb4081878e9:19

value
3030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5281ba0bd1bee85674f70f66d4c0d849a54872a9 OP_EQUALVERIFY OP_CHECKSIG
address
18XFpJXd2eJstPunU2USqSg8FsEpBQfTQt
transaction
88f75544664fcdbb18e292f7e8adb605d3db824fc5ce998ff65cabb4081878e9
spent
true